indentured <br />13.2 Contractors shall at all times comply with the applicable provisions of the California <br />Labor Code, the payment of prevailing wages, the registration of contractors and subcontractors, <br />and the hiring of apprentices, in addition to the requirements of Article 8. <br />13.3 The apprentice ratios will be in compliance with the applicable provisions of the <br />California Labor Code and Prevailing Wage Rate Determinations. <br />13.4 HELMETS TO HARDHATS: <br />13.4.1 The Contractor(s)/Employer(s) and the Unions recognize a desire to facilitate the entry <br />into the building and construction trades of veterans who are interested in careers in the building <br />and construction industry. The Contractor(s)/ Employer(s) and Unions agree to utilize the <br />services of the Center for Military Recruitment, Assessment and Veterans Employment <br />(hereinafter "Center) and the Center's "Helmets to Hardhats" program to serve as a resource for <br />preliminary orientation, assessment of construction aptitude, referral to apprenticeship programs <br />or hiring halls, counseling and mentoring, support network, employment opportunities and other <br />needs as identified by the parties. <br />13.4.2 The Unions and Contractor(s)/Employer(s) agree to coordinate with the Center to <br />participate in an integrated database of veterans interested in working on the Projects and of <br />apprenticeship and employment opportunities for the Projects. To the extent permitted by law, <br />the Unions will give credit to such veterans for bona fide, provable past experience. <br />ARTICLE 14 <br />MANAGEMENT RIGHTS <br />14.1 The Contractor shall retain full and exclusive authority for the management of its <br />operations, including the right to direct its work force in its sole discretion except as otherwise <br />limited by the terms of this agreement and/or Schedule A Agreements.
